Lengthened fast-assembly nut
By designing an extended quick-install nut and utilizing a slide rail and slot structure, the problem of inconvenient installation of bathroom fixture nuts in confined spaces has been solved, achieving a convenient and secure connection.

The nuts in existing bathroom fixtures are inconvenient to install and remove in confined spaces, and the sleeve length of quick-installation nuts is fixed, making it impossible to balance ease of installation and secureness.
An extended quick-install nut has been designed, including a nut body and a socket. Through the cooperation of the slide rail and the slot, the socket slider is allowed to slide on the slide rail and be engaged in the slot, extending or shortening the gripping part, so as to realize convenient installation and firm connection of the nut.
It enables quick installation and removal of nuts in confined spaces, enhancing the convenience and strength of assembly, while not affecting the pull-out effect of the water pipe.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of bathroom equipment assembly structure technology, and in particular to an extended quick-release nut. Background Technology
[0002] In existing technology, when assembling bathroom fixtures such as faucets and inlet valves, they are usually fixed by means of screws and nuts. For example, when assembling a faucet, an external thread is provided on the mounting and fixing threaded tube of the faucet, and the threaded section of the mounting and fixing threaded tube is set to be relatively long. Then, a nut is screwed onto the mounting and fixing threaded tube of the faucet, thereby fixing the faucet to the mounting panel.
[0003] Because the installation space for the faucet is limited, or the fixed installation location is not visible, it is inconvenient to screw on the nut, making quick installation impossible. When installing the nut, it is screwed in along the external thread of the faucet's mounting tube; when removing the nut, it is screwed out in the opposite direction along the external thread of the mounting tube. The screwing-in and screwing-out stroke of the nut is relatively long, making quick installation and removal impossible.
[0004] To address the aforementioned issues, publication number CN111005925A discloses a quick-installation nut to enable rapid installation and removal. However, since the water pipe needs to pass through the middle of the nut, the length of the sleeve portion gripped by the quick-installation nut cannot be too long, otherwise it may interfere with the water pipe and affect the rapid installation. Furthermore, the length of the sleeve portion is fixed and cannot be lengthened. On the other hand, if the length of the sleeve portion is set to be too short, it is difficult to rotate the nut for installation, resulting in insufficient installation firmness and easy loosening. [0026]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, an extended quick-install nut according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a nut body 1 and a sleeve 2.
[0027] The nut body 1 includes a threaded portion 11 and a sleeve portion 12 connected to each other. The threaded portion 11 and the sleeve portion 12 are cylindrical, and the inner sidewall of the threaded portion 11 forms an internal thread. The structure of the threaded portion 11 can be the structure disclosed in publication number CN111005925A, or it can be other structures, the specific structure of which will not be described here. The threaded portion 11 is used for quick connection with the screw.
[0028] The outer wall of the sleeve portion 12, near the screw portion 11, is provided with a hanging member 121. The outer wall of the sleeve portion 12 is axially provided with a slide rail 122. At the end of the outer wall of the sleeve portion 12 away from the screw portion 11, a groove 123 communicating with the slide rail 122 is provided circumferentially. The hanging member 121 can be a protrusion with a downward-facing inclined guide surface on its upper side and an upward-facing inclined guide surface on its lower side. In this invention, the part near the screw portion 11 is the upper part, and the part away from the screw portion 11 is the lower part. The hanging member 121 is located above the upper end of the slide rail 122. The slide rail 122 can be a groove provided on the sleeve portion 12. The groove 123 is located at the lower end of the slide rail 122. Optionally, the upper and lower side walls of the groove 123 of the sleeve portion 12 are configured as upward-sloping surfaces.
[0029] The socket 2 is cylindrical and is sleeved on the sleeve portion 12 of the nut body 1. The upper part of the inner side wall of the socket 2 is provided with a slider 21 that can slide in the slide rail 122. The upper part of the inner side wall of the socket 2 is also provided with a groove 22 for the hanging piece 121 to be inserted. The groove 22 can be set around the circumference of the socket 2, and its circumferential width is greater than the circumferential width of the hanging piece 121, so that the hanging piece 121 can be inserted into the groove 22.
[0030] When assembling the nut, the slider 21 of the socket 2 slides down along the slide rail 122 of the socket part 12 of the nut body 1. Usually, it slides down to the lower end of the slide rail 122. Then, the socket 2 is rotated so that its slider 21 is engaged in the slot 123 of the socket part 12 of the nut body 1 for limiting, thereby extending the socket part 12 of the nut body 1. The socket 2 continues to rotate, causing the threaded part 11 of the nut body 1 to rotate as well, so as to realize the threaded connection between the threaded part 11 of the nut body 1 and the screw, making the assembly more convenient and the assembly more secure.
[0031] After assembly, in use, the slider 21 of the socket 2 slides up along the slide rail 122 of the socket part 12 of the nut body 1 to near the screw part 11, usually sliding up to the upper end of the slide rail 122. At this time, the hanging part 121 of the socket part 12 is engaged in the groove 22 of the socket 2, so that the socket 2 returns to its original position without falling down, thereby increasing the convenience of nut installation without affecting the faucet water pipe pulling effect.
[0032] Optionally, the outer side wall of the socket 12, away from the screw portion 11, is provided with a protrusion 124. The protrusion 124 is located above the slot 123 to abut against the socket 2. Specifically, the inner side wall of the upper end of the socket 2 is provided with a ramp 23 to abut against the protrusion. The slider 21 of the socket 2 slides down along the slide rail 122 of the socket 12 of the nut body 1, and then the socket 2 is rotated so that its slider 21 is engaged in the slot 123 of the socket 12 of the nut body 1 for limiting. At this time, the protrusion 124 abuts against the ramp 23 of the socket 2 to prevent the socket 2 from falling back along the slot 123, making the rotation of the socket 2 convenient.
[0033] Optionally, the outer side wall of the sleeve portion 12, away from the threaded portion 11, is provided with a raised rib 125 along the axial direction. The raised rib 125 is located on one side of the slide rail 122 and opposite to the slot 123. The inner side wall of the upper end of the sleeve 2 is provided with a relief portion 24 corresponding to the raised rib 125. The bottom of the relief portion 24 is a step 25 to abut against the bottom of the raised rib 125. The slider 21 of the sleeve 2 slides down along the slide rail 122 of the sleeve portion 12 of the nut body 1, and then the sleeve 2 is rotated so that its slider 21 is engaged in the slot 123 of the sleeve portion 12 of the nut body 1 for limiting. At this time, the bottom of the raised rib 125 abuts against the step 25 of the relief portion 24 to increase the force-bearing surface of the sleeve 2 when it rotates, thereby enhancing the force-bearing strength of the sleeve 2.
[0034] Optionally, the lower end of the sleeve portion 12 is provided with a C-shaped groove 126 along the axial direction to suspend the hose. The C-shaped groove 126 can limit the hose and prevent it from loosening.
